OVERVIEW** **Alloy 45**, commercially known as **Low Expansion 45 Alloy**, is a specialized **nickel-iron alloy** containing **45% nickel** that delivers a **controlled coefficient of thermal expansion (CTE)** between traditional low-expansion alloys and standard fitting materials. Manufactured as **precision fittings**, these components ensure reliable thermal compatibility and dimensional stability in piping systems requiring intermediate expansion characteristics with excellent pressure integrity. --- ### **2. CHEMICAL COMPOSITION (Weight %)** | Element | Alloy 45 Fittings Specification | Typical Range | |------------------|--------------------------------|---------------| | **Nickel (Ni)** | 44.0 – 46.0% | 44.5 – 45.5% | | **Iron (Fe)** | Balance | Balance | | **Manganese (Mn)**| 0.30 – 0.70% | 0.40 – 0.60% | | **Silicon (Si)** | 0.15 – 0.30% | 0.20 – 0.25% | | **Carbon (C)** | ≤ 0.05% | ≤ 0.03% | | **Chromium (Cr)**| ≤ 0.15% | ≤ 0.10% | | **Copper (Cu)** | ≤ 0.05% | ≤ 0.03% | | **Aluminum (Al)**| ≤ 0.05% | ≤ 0.03% | | **Sulfur (S)** | ≤ 0.015% | ≤ 0.010% | | **Phosphorus (P)**| ≤ 0.015% | ≤ 0.010% | --- ### **3. PHYSICAL & MECHANICAL PROPERTIES** | Property | Typical Value (Annealed) | |---------------------------------|--------------------------| | **CTE (20–300°C)** | 6.5 – 7.5 × 10⁻⁶/°C | | **Density** | 8.17 g/cm³ | | **Melting Point** | 1425 – 1450°C | | **Tensile Strength** | 550 – 650 MPa | | **Yield Strength (0.2% Offset)**| 320 – 420 MPa | | **Elongation (in 2")** | 25 – 35% | | **Modulus of Elasticity** | 148 GPa | | **Hardness (Rockwell B)** | 75 – 90 HRB | | **Electrical Resistivity** | 0.80 μΩ·m | | **Thermal Conductivity** | 15.0 W/m·K | | **Pressure Rating** | Schedule 40/80 compatible | --- ### **4.
